The picturesque town of Gulmarg played host to the 5th edition of the Khelo India Winter Games, which concluded on Wednesday. Sports Minister Mansukh Mandaviya highlighted the event's success and stressed the commitment to advancing the sports sector in Kashmir.

The Indian Army dominated the competition, collecting 18 medals, including seven golds, and maintaining their title from the previous edition. A commendable performance by Himachal Pradesh saw them earn the runner-up spot, ending with six golds. However, the Army's experience and strategic preparation gave them the edge.

This year's event, which included over 750 athletes from diverse regions, showcased India's growing interest in winter sports. Notably, states like Maharashtra and Tamil Nadu impressed despite lacking natural winter sports terrains. The games' success underscores the central government's efforts in promoting these niche sports nationwide.
